@MichaelMinard13@perezllorca It’s not about how it looks from the front—it’s about the wiring on the back. I hate when other installers can’t provide all the rack screws. A bunch are missing. It’s literally the cheapest component in the rack. I do like those AudioControl amps 😎
It's definitely better than 75% of installers, though there are many things we would have done differently—for example, using custom-length Velcro wire straps instead of zip ties to secure the wires. Power cables on the right side of the rack, low-voltage cables on the left side. Ventilation is a must, both intake and exhaust, especially if they plan to close it with a door. That's just a few things, I don’t want to write an article about it 😅
